Air Arabia Abu Dhabi's Maiden Flight to Colombo

Air Arabia Abu Dhabi has marked a historic milestone with the successful launch of its inaugural flight to Colombo. This development signifies the airline's expansion into new international routes, connecting the capital of the United Arab Emirates with the vibrant city in Sri Lanka.

The introduction of this new route underscores Air Arabia Abu Dhabi's commitment to providing accessible and efficient air travel options to passengers. Colombo, as a key destination, adds to the airline's growing network, catering to the increasing demand for connectivity between the UAE and popular international hubs.

Passengers can now benefit from enhanced travel options, and the new flight is expected to facilitate tourism, trade, and cultural exchanges between Abu Dhabi and Colombo. As Air Arabia Abu Dhabi extends its reach, this inaugural flight sets the stage for continued growth and strengthened air connectivity between the UAE and Sri Lanka.

Railways approves major upgrade for Telangana traction lines

The Ministry of Railways has approved the upgradation of the electric traction system in two crucial railway sections — Medchal–Mudkhed (225 km) and Mahbubnagar–Dhone (184 km). The projects, costing Rs 1.93 billion and Rs 1.23 billion respectively, will enhance the electric traction capacity from 1X25 KV to 2X25 KV. The work includes modifications to circuit breakers and switching stations, along with the installation of additional conductors. Adani to invest Rs 425 billion more in Maharashtra’s Dighi Port

The Adani Group has committed to invest an additional Rs 425 billion in the Dighi Port project, located along Maharashtra’s coastal Konkan belt, government officials announced on Monday. Adani Ports and Special Economic Zone (APSEZ)-run Dighi Ports sign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) with the Maharashtra government to undertake the expansion of the port and related infrastructure. This new commitment comes as part of a broader investment initiative by the state.
